Cert Decoder is a free online tool that helps you decode X.509 SSL/TLS certificates in PEM format. It instantly shows important information like the issuer, expiry date, SAN entries, and fingerprint. All data is processed locally in your browser, so nothing is ever sent or stored elsewhere.
